@@ -35,25 +35,22 @@
 # using a macro with the same name in our local m4/libtool.m4 it'll
 # pull the old libtool.m4 in (it doesn't see our shiny new m4_define
 # and doesn't know about Autoconf macros at all.)
-#
+# 
 # So we provide this file, which has a silly filename so it's always
 # included after everything else.  This provides aclocal with the
 # AU_DEFUNs it wants, but when m4 processes it, it doesn't do anything
 # because those macros already exist.
-#
+# 
 # Anytime we withdraw an AC_DEFUN or AU_DEFUN, but still refer to it,
 # remember to add it here.
